Solitude Loop Trail
This run-hike climb rises in Wyoming. Expect 34 to 57 minutes. The hardest 500 metres average 18.0% and start 3.0 km in, so the worst of it lands when you are already committed. South-facing, so it is hot in summer and one of the first to clear of snow. At 3.0 TEP it sits in the easier half of the catalogue.
